So I managed to take a day off work and made a start on detailing my new Audi. Picked the car up on Tuesday and looked relatively clean.
Quick jetwash then snowfoamed:
Rinsed then washed with two bucket method.
Then used Iron X to remove fallout. Car looked pretty clean after wash but as you can see quite alot of fallout!
Then did the wheels, again as you can see alot of fallout, mind you to be expected on the wheels!
Car has a few scratches, but nothing major, typical example of what I have to correct:
Started correction using Menzerna PF2500 with yellow pad.
